[nfbcs] Creating Jaws or NVDA Accessible UML and ER Diagrams

Sabra Ewing sabra1023 at gmail.com
Tue Jan 16 21:55:36 UTC 2018


They have various pieces of software where you can write code or pseudo code and it will convert it into a diagram.

Sabra Ewing

> On Jan 16, 2018, at 12:59 PM, Currin, Kevin via nfbcs <nfbcs at nfbnet.org> wrote:
> 
> For ER diagrams, I assign an object to one type of shape (say square) and its attributes to another shape (say circle). I then position an object on the x-y grid, position its attributes a few spaces away on multiple sides, and draw undirected lines between objects and attributes. For inheritance, I draw directed lines between objects. I try to arrange objects and attributes so that attributes are to the left and right of objects (and at slight angles if needed to fit all attributes) and related objects up and down from each other. 
> 
> This is just a method I used in the past and is just a template; you should use your own creativity combined with instructor preferences for your graphs. Just be sure to clearly describe the choices that you made to your instructor in case it looks slightly different from the conventions used by sighted students. 
> 
> I've never made a UML diragram. If it can be made with line and node graphs, then you should be able to do it with GSK.
> 
> 
> ________________________________________
> From: nfbcs [nfbcs-bounces at nfbnet.org] on behalf of Timothy Breitenfeldt via nfbcs [nfbcs at nfbnet.org]
> Sent: Friday, January 12, 2018 9:26 PM
> To: NFB in Computer Science Mailing List
> Cc: Timothy Breitenfeldt
> Subject: Re: [nfbcs] Creating Jaws or NVDA Accessible UML and ER Diagrams
> 
> Wow, this is a pretty cool peace of software. How are you useing it to
> create ER diagrams. I downloaded it and played with it a little, but I
> am not sure if I understand all of its capabilities. Do you think I
> could use this for UML?
> 
> TJ Breitenfeldt
> 
>> On 1/12/18, Currin, Kevin via nfbcs <nfbcs at nfbnet.org> wrote:
>> I use gsk:
>> https://research.csc.ncsu.edu/accessibility/GSK/index.html
>> 
>> This allows you to make node and line graphs, which can be used to construct
>> ER diagrams. I haven’t used it since it was updated from Java to c# but it’s
>> probably easier to use now because of that.
>> Let me know if you have any questions, Kevin Sent from my iPhone
>> 
>> On Jan 12, 2018, at 8:32 PM, Timothy Breitenfeldt via nfbcs
>> <nfbcs at nfbnet.org<mailto:nfbcs at nfbnet.org>> wrote:
>> 
>> Hi, I am new to the list. I am a blind computer science major, and I
>> am taking design patterns and relational databases this quarter. In
>> both of these classes, I have to create diagrams for design purposes.
>> In my design patterns class, I am learning UML to model object
>> oriented programs, and my relational database class is teaching me how
>> to create ER diagrams. I am looking for a solution as a screenreader
>> user to be able to create and read these types of diagrams.
>> 
>> Does anyone have any experience or suggestions on how I can handle this?
>> 
>> Thanks,
>> 
>> TJ Breitenfeldt
>> 
>> _______________________________________________
>> nfbcs mailing list
>> nfbcs at nfbnet.org<mailto:nfbcs at nfbnet.org>
>> http://nfbnet.org/mailman/listinfo/nfbcs_nfbnet.org
>> To unsubscribe, change your list options or get your account info for
>> nfbcs:
>> http://nfbnet.org/mailman/options/nfbcs_nfbnet.org/kwcurrin%40email.unc.edu
>> _______________________________________________
>> nfbcs mailing list
>> nfbcs at nfbnet.org
>> http://nfbnet.org/mailman/listinfo/nfbcs_nfbnet.org
>> To unsubscribe, change your list options or get your account info for nfbcs:
>> http://nfbnet.org/mailman/options/nfbcs_nfbnet.org/timothyjb310%40gmail.com
>> 
> 
> _______________________________________________
> nfbcs mailing list
> nfbcs at nfbnet.org
> http://nfbnet.org/mailman/listinfo/nfbcs_nfbnet.org
> To unsubscribe, change your list options or get your account info for nfbcs:
> http://nfbnet.org/mailman/options/nfbcs_nfbnet.org/kwcurrin%40email.unc.edu
> 
> _______________________________________________
> nfbcs mailing list
> nfbcs at nfbnet.org
> http://nfbnet.org/mailman/listinfo/nfbcs_nfbnet.org
> To unsubscribe, change your list options or get your account info for nfbcs:
> http://nfbnet.org/mailman/options/nfbcs_nfbnet.org/sabra1023%40gmail.com




More information about the NFBCS mailing list